## Versioning

The Hearthkit component library follows strict semantic versioning. Minor releases are published nightly from the integration branch; major releases require release-manager approval through the Lampwright publishing service. Consumers pin to a major version and receive patches automatically. To publish a release or query available versions, the Lampwright API requires authentication on every request. Authenticate publishing calls with the key below.

gateway credential: kto3_qfe

Subject: Drone unit back for servicing — routing

Dispatch desk,

For the coordinator: aerial unit Skimmer-4 from the Bellvale survey fleet is being returned to Aldercroft Robotics for scheduled servicing. It's crated and waiting in the returns bay with its battery removed and taped to the lid. Please schedule a driver for tomorrow's morning run and flag it as fragile electronics. The hand-over at Aldercroft must follow the confidential instruction below.

handover note for yagef-bagep: the drudor pelius courier leaves the kasdor zorvan norir ledger at gate 8016 under passcode 755406

Fan-out backpressure for the Quillet notifier: when the queue depth crosses the soft limit, the dispatcher sheds low-priority pushes and batches the rest at 500ms intervals. Reviewer should confirm the shed counter is exported and that retries respect the jitter window. Once merged, the release artifact gets re-signed by the pipeline, which expects the deploy key shown below.

deploy key for bawep-yawif: bky6_GQhaSt

Subject: Handover — PortionPal 2.4 release

Hi Darvek,

Taking over release duties for PortionPal, the recipe-scaling calculator, effective Monday. The fraction-rounding fix for metric conversions is merged and tagged; the scaling matrix tests pass on all three runners. Please review the changelog before you cut the build — the yield-adjustment notes were rewritten. Artifacts go to the Larkmoor registry as usual. The build must be signed before upload, so here is the current release signing key.

signing key of bagap-yawep = bky13_TbfT6ZMUoGJo2